University of Washington, Seattle
USDA inspection reports for the University of
Washington, Seattle (UW) reveal multiple violations for 4/1/03. Expired
food was being given to cats and guinea pigs. Water was being denied to
rabbits in the Comparative Medicine Building. The watering system had been
disconnected for a period of 48 hours without being noticed by the animal
care staff.
Internal documents obtained from the UW indicate
significant problems in areas of primate care. One primate (K93464) died
(9/01) as a result of ingesting a set of latex gloves. Another primate
(T93497) died (1/01) after being anesthetized for a blood draw,
potentially as a result of anesthetic overdose. Another primate (#93169)
died (7/00) of anesthetic overdose. Two primates (A00131 & 98026) in the
care of investigator CC Tsai died with "total absence of body fat stores"
and "total absence of subcutaneous fat." Dehydration is also discussed in
reference to primate #98026. Primate F93276 died 6/01 is discussed as
having "Malnutrition, chronic, severe" and "Dehydration, severe."
